AWeb is a web browser for the Amiga range of computers. Originally developed by Yvon Rozijn, AWeb was shipped with version 3.9 of AmigaOS, and is now open source.

AWeb supports HTML 3.2, and some 4.1, JavaScript, frames, SSL, and various other Netscape and Internet Explorer features.

History

Version 4: AWeb APL

The fourth version of AWeb, to be known as AWeb APL, will be based on the KHTML engine. Porting of the engine to the Amiga began in late 2004.[4]
